Job Description:
Behaviour Mentor
Location: Leicester, LE3
Daily Pay: £95-£105 per day
Hours of Work: 8:30am - 3:30pm / 35 hours per week (term-time only)
Start Date: September
Classroom Support responsibilities:
* Work with individuals and small groups of students within a classroom situation to ensure each child has the maximum access to all learning activities.
* In liaison with teaching staff, plan, prepare and deliver the support needed, developing strategies to achieving positive behavioural outcomes.
* Support teaching staff with appropriate strategies when dealing with challenging behaviour.
* Ensure pupils receive regular and constructive feedback with regards to their progress.
Additional Student Support responsibilities:
* Arrange and develop 1-1mentoring programmes to support students in managing their own classroom behaviour and learning.
* Work with teaching staff in the planning and implementation of individual behaviour support programmes for named children or small groups.
* Meeting individual children or small groups to support them through withdrawal from classes or through meetings arranged at other times in the school day.
* Develop and deliver group workshops for students identified with Behavioural, Social and Emotional Difficulties (SEMH).
* Liaise with Alternative Education Providers, parents and teaching staff on student progress.
* Challenge and motivate students to promote self-esteem.
Criteria:
* Have at least one years’ experience working within a school or working with children in a support based setting.
* Role open to youth workers, sports coaches and candidates working in Summer Camps
* Have excellent interpersonal and communication skills.
* Be able to quickly build relationships with students and staff
* Enhanced DBS Certificate (within 1 year or on the update service)
* 2 X references
* Right to work in the UK
